Commercial vs. Residential HVAC: Key Differences


When it comes to heating, air flow, and air conditioning methods, distinguishing between commercial and residential units is essential. Both techniques serve the same basic objective, however their scale, components, and purposes differ significantly. Understanding these differences might help owners, business house owners, and contractors make knowledgeable decisions relating to installation, maintenance, and repairs.

The measurement of the systems is among the most notable variations. Commercial HVAC systems are typically much larger than those designed for residential use. They need to accommodate the requirements of larger buildings, which regularly have multiple flooring and extra expansive square footage. This increased scale directly influences system design, efficiency, and installation procedures.


Building codes and requirements additionally differ significantly between commercial and residential HVAC methods. Commercial buildings must comply with stricter rules to make sure safety, accessibility, and efficiency in larger environments. Local and federal codes dictate particular installation practices, materials, and technologies that may not apply to residential techniques. These laws aim to make certain that commercial methods operate safely in high-occupancy environments.


Energy efficiency performs a pivotal position in both forms of techniques but is often approached in one other way. Commercial HVAC systems are usually designed with greater efficiency standards in thoughts. Businesses typically face greater scrutiny concerning their power consumption and environmental impact. Consequently, many commercial techniques embrace superior applied sciences, such as variable refrigerant move and vitality recovery techniques, to optimize efficiency.


Conversely, residential methods may prioritize user-friendly options and aesthetics. Homeowners could also be extra concerned with the consolation levels and total performance of their HVAC units. Though power efficiency is an important consideration for owners, it isn't at all times the driving factor behind the number of residential units. As a outcome, residential models can typically focus extra on comfort somewhat than maximum power efficiency.

Zoning capabilities characterize another area where commercial and residential techniques differ significantly. Many commercial HVAC systems make use of zoning technologies, permitting various areas of a constructing to maintain up different temperatures as wanted. This ability to customise climate control is particularly helpful for giant facilities with various usage patterns, the place each zone might require a different temperature setting.


In distinction, residential systems usually offer much less complexity regarding zoning. While some householders put cash into zoned systems, many residential models are designed to provide whole-house heating and cooling. This strategy streamlines installation and reduces prices, making it more accessible for common homeowners. However, it could also result in uneven heating or cooling in bigger homes with out adequate zoning.


The installation process additionally diverges between commercial and residential HVAC systems. Commercial installations are sometimes extra complex, requiring specialised tools and trained technicians. The dimension and scale of commercial methods necessitate a extra comprehensive strategy that features managing ducts, air flow, and electrical systems. This complexity can typically result in extended installation occasions and better prices.

On the opposite hand, residential installations tend to be less complicated and quicker. Homeowners usually seek streamlined installation processes that require minimal disruption. Additionally, many residential techniques can be put in with much less labor-intensive methods, permitting technicians to complete the work extra efficiently while providing a more reasonably priced solution for householders.


Maintenance practices diverge as nicely. Commercial systems regularly endure more rigorous and common maintenance checks. Given their bigger scale and more vital potential for points, businesses typically schedule preventive maintenance at common intervals. This proactive approach is significant for minimizing downtime and guaranteeing efficiency, which directly affects the underside line.

Residential techniques, while not immune from maintenance needs, could not require the same degree of consideration. Homeowners generally comply with a seasonal maintenance schedule, which entails fundamental duties like changing filters, checking thermostats, and cleansing ducts. Though common maintenance is crucial for extending the lifespan of HVAC methods, the frequency and scope differ greatly between commercial and residential settings (AC Installation Canoga Park).


Technology advancements also manifest in distinct ways between commercial and residential HVAC systems. Commercial systems frequently incorporate innovative applied sciences meant to handle larger-scale HVAC challenges. Many embody superior control methods, which allow for remote monitoring and management. These systems allow facility managers to optimize efficiency in real-time, making certain efficiency throughout in depth networks of HVAC equipment.

Residential methods, whereas they do embrace technology-driven options like sensible thermostats, might not reach the same level of complexity as their commercial counterparts. Instead, advancements often focus on improving user convenience, such as built-in good residence functionalities. Homeowner preferences usually lean in the direction of usability and straightforward controls, fulfilling their heating and cooling wants with out extreme problems.


The lifespan of HVAC methods also varies significantly between commercial and residential functions. Generally, commercial HVAC techniques are constructed to endure longer operating hours and harsher circumstances. This extended operational lifespan can lead to larger upfront prices but represents an investment in long-term efficiency and reliability.


In distinction, residential techniques might have a shorter lifespan mainly because of their usage patterns. Homeowners usually don't run their HVAC models continuously, resulting in put on and tear that results in a different rate of getting older. While higher-quality residential methods look at this site can offer longevity, most are designed for much less in depth usage, impacting total sturdiness.

Commercial HVAC techniques are typically bigger, extra complicated, and designed to chill or heat larger areas such as workplaces or warehouses, whereas residential systems are smaller and designed for single-family houses or residences. Commercial methods usually have multiple zones and more superior controls to manage varying hundreds across giant areas.

What are the upkeep wants for commercial HVAC methods in comparability with residential ones?


Commercial HVAC systems require extra frequent and thorough maintenance as a result of their larger dimension and operational demands. They usually have extra specialised elements that need common checks, whereas residential methods usually require less frequent servicing targeted primarily on filter changes and system inspections.

How do power efficiency standards differ between commercial and residential HVAC systems?


Energy efficiency requirements can differ significantly, as commercial HVAC techniques are subject to stricter rules due to their larger vitality consumption. Residential systems should meet minimum efficiency necessities but usually have more lenient requirements compared to commercial ones.


What are the prices associated with commercial HVAC methods compared to residential ones?


Commercial HVAC techniques generally have greater upfront costs because of larger gear and extra complicated installations. The operational prices can also differ considerably, turning into cost-effective in the long term as a outcome of energy efficiencies that large-scale methods can present.


HVAC Services Canoga Park AC & Heating Services - HVAC Contractor




Can commercial HVAC methods be scaled or customized as needs change?


Yes, commercial HVAC techniques could be scaled and customised based on particular needs, permitting for modifications as businesses grow or change. This scalability lets firms adapt their HVAC systems to completely different space requirements or technological upgrades over time.
